[Pdns-users] Negative cache upon zone creation

Andrea Biscuola andrea.biscuola at host.it
Fri Feb 25 08:29:32 UTC 2022


Hi.

On Thu, 24 Feb 2022 21:15:04 +0100
Klaus Darilion <klaus.darilion at nic.at> wrote:

> IIRC you are right. But there were several updatest o the zone cache after release. If you use 4.5 make sure to use latest 4.5.x version. regards
> Klaus

And that's exactly what we do. The "real" authoritative DNS servers are updated using
the MySQL replication mechanism, non through the APIs.

> -----Ursprüngliche Nachricht-----
> Von: Lucas Rolff <lucas at lucasrolff.com> 
> Gesendet: Donnerstag, 24. Februar 2022 16:58
> An: Klaus Darilion <klaus.darilion at nic.at>
> Cc: Andrea Biscuola <andrea.biscuola at host.it>; Pdns-users at mailman.powerdns.com
> Betreff: Re: [Pdns-users] Negative cache upon zone creation
> 
> zone-cache-refresh-interval should only be changed if updating the backend directly right? If using the API, this setting shouldn’t matter - as far as I know, the API will invalidate the zone-cache.
> 
> > On 24 Feb 2022, at 23:30, Klaus Darilion via Pdns-users <Pdns-users at mailman.powerdns.com> wrote:
> > 
> > Have you really disabled all caches? Also https://doc.powerdns.com/authoritative/settings.html#zone-cache-refresh-interval ?
> > regards
> > Klaus
> > 
> > -----Ursprüngliche Nachricht-----
> > Von: Pdns-users <pdns-users-bounces at mailman.powerdns.com> Im Auftrag von Andrea Biscuola via Pdns-users
> > Gesendet: Donnerstag, 24. Februar 2022 15:12
> > An: pdns-users at mailman.powerdns.com
> > Betreff: [Pdns-users] Negative cache upon zone creation
> > 
> > Hello.
> > 
> > In our PowerDNS setup, all of the PowerDNS authoritative server caches are turned off, apart for the max-packet-cache-entries setting that is set to the default, as the same service is given by a series of DNSDist daemons running on top of the PowerDNS ones.
> > 
> > However, querying one of the PowerDNS servers directly for a zone that does not exists, extends the negative response way after we created the zone. This affects some automated systems, where the DNS servers are automatically changed a the registrar, causing the registrar verification process to fail.
> > 
> > So, to recap:
> > 
> > 1 - We query PowerDNS (NOT DNSDist) for a non existing zone.
> > 2 - Correctly, PowerDNS responds that the zone does not exists.
> > 3 - In the meantime we create the zone.
> > 4 - PowerDNS continues to respond with a negative response after the zone is created.
> > 5 - PowerDNS gives us the proper response, only after we stop querying it for some time.
> > 
> > Are we missing something? Or is it expected to work just like that? Then we could accomodate our software for that.
> > 
> > Thank you.
> > 
> > Andrea
> > _______________________________________________
> > Pdns-users mailing list
> > Pdns-users at mailman.powerdns.com
> > https://mailman.powerdns.com/mailman/listinfo/pdns-users
> > _______________________________________________
> > Pdns-users mailing list
> > Pdns-users at mailman.powerdns.com
> > https://mailman.powerdns.com/mailman/listinfo/pdns-users  
> 




Andrea


More information about the Pdns-users mailing list